Hierarchical Z-scheme photocatalyst g-C3N4/Au/ZnIn2S4 was constructed and applied for highly enhanced visible-light photocatalytic NO removal and CO2 conversion.

The utilization of catalyst waste from nitric oxide removal at thermoelectric power plants for supercapacitor fabrication is proposed; the electrochemical performance of the resultant supercapacitors is comparable to that of current state-of-the-art supercapacitor systems.
